Senior Quality Assurance Engineer for API Development

hace 4 días


Barcelona, Barcelona, España Semrush A tiempo completo

About the Role

We are seeking a skilled Senior Quality Assurance Engineer to join our Iris Team in developing high-quality APIs for digital marketers. The ideal candidate will have hands-on experience in automated testing, test automation frameworks, and continuous integration systems.

Job Description

In this role, you will be responsible for designing and implementing automated tests, executing manual and automatic tests on the product API and services during development and pre-release phases, creating and supporting end-to-end autotests, and influencing the development of the product by defining corner cases and improving test coverage.

Requirements

  • PRACTICAL EXPERIENCE IN AUTOMATED TESTING OF WEB SERVICES
  • BACKGROUND IN IMPLEMENTING AUTOMATED TESTING IN PROJECTS WITH GO, JAVA, JAVASCRIPT, OR TYPESCRIPT
  • EXPERIENCE WITH CONTINUOUS INTEGRATION SYSTEMS AND PERFECT GITHUB/CODEPEN/CI/CD
  • READINESS TO DIG INTO THE BUSINESS LOGIC OF OUR SERVICES
  • READINESS TO SUPPORT AND IMPROVE A TESTING PROCESS AND BUILD IT FROM SCRATCH IN SOME CASES

Preferred Qualifications

  • KNOWLEDGE OF GO
  • API TESTING EXPERIENCE (REST/PROTOBUF/GRPC)
  • KNOWLEDGE OF APPLICATION PROFILING PRACTICES
  • EXPERIENCE WITH GCP/AWS/KUBERNETES BUILDING DISTRIBUTED SYSTEMS
  • EXPERIENCE WITH DEVOPS
  • EXPERIENCE WITH ONE OF THESE TOOLS PLAYWRIGHT CUCUMBER
  • EXPERIENCE WITH DATABASES (QUERIES WITH A COUPLE OF JOINS SHOULD NOT CAUSE PANIC)
  • KNOWLEDGE OF THE VERSION CONTROL SYSTEM (GITHUB/GITLAB)

About Us

We value openness, responsibility, involvement, and willingness to share and gain new knowledge. We offer a remote work format with flexible working days, unlimited PTO, hobby benefits, breakfast snacks and coffee at the office, corporate events, training courses, conferences, and gifts for employees. Our team is cross-functional and self-organized, working under Agile principles with Scrum framework.

Salary Estimate

The estimated salary for this position is around $120,000 - $150,000 per year, based on average salaries for similar positions in the United States.



  • Barcelona, Barcelona, España Semrush A tiempo completo

    About the RoleSemrush is seeking a skilled Quality Assurance Engineer to join our Iris Team. As a key member of our development team, you will be responsible for ensuring the high quality of our digital marketing platform's API interfaces.Key Responsibilities- Develop and maintain automated tests for our API interfaces- Collaborate with cross-functional...


  • Barcelona, Barcelona, España Studentuniverse A tiempo completo

    Job Title: Senior Quality Assurance EngineerAbout the Role:We are seeking a skilled Senior Quality Assurance Engineer to join our team at WhereTo. As a key member of our software development team, you will be responsible for ensuring the high quality of our AI-powered travel platform for corporate travel.Key Responsibilities:Work in an Agile environment and...


  • Barcelona, Barcelona, España Qmenta A tiempo completo

    We are seeking a seasoned Senior Quality Assurance Engineer to lead our quality assurance efforts. As a key member of our team, you will be responsible for ensuring the highest quality standards are met for our products. In this role, you will collaborate closely with our development team to identify and mitigate risks, and develop testing strategies to...


  • Barcelona, Barcelona, España Adp A tiempo completo

    Quality Assurance EngineerADP is seeking a Quality Assurance Engineer to join our development team. As a Quality Assurance Engineer, you will be responsible for designing and implementing automated tests using Playwright for UI, API, visual, and accessibility testing. You will work closely with developers to ensure testability of features and implement best...


  • Barcelona, Barcelona, España Studentuniverse A tiempo completo

    Job Opportunity:We are seeking a skilled Senior Quality Assurance Engineer to join our team in Barcelona. As a key member of our QA team, you will be responsible for implementing test strategies, creating functional automation tests, and performing API testing for our software products.Key Responsibilities:Develop and implement test strategies to ensure...


  • Barcelona, Barcelona, España Automatic Data Processing, Inc. A tiempo completo

    Quality Assurance EngineerAutomatic Data Processing, Inc. is seeking a Quality Assurance Engineer to join its development team. As a Quality Assurance Engineer, you will be responsible for designing, developing, and executing automated tests using Playwright for UI, API, visual, and accessibility testing. You will also create and execute comprehensive test...


  • Barcelona, Barcelona, España Adp A tiempo completo

    **ADP is seeking a talented Software Quality Assurance Engineer to join our dynamic team**.As a Quality Assurance Engineer, you will play a critical role in developing and debugging ADP's cloud-based AI and machine learning-enhanced payroll, tax, HR, and benefits solutions.You will work closely with our development team to identify and prioritize test cases,...


  • Barcelona, Barcelona, España Automatic Data Processing, Inc. A tiempo completo

    Software Quality Assurance EngineerADP is seeking a skilled Software Quality Assurance Engineer to join our development team. As a key member of our team, you will be responsible for designing and implementing high-quality automation scripts to test our cloud-based AI and machine learning-enhanced payroll, tax, HR, and benefits solutions.Key...


  • Barcelona, Barcelona, España Adp A tiempo completo

    About the RoleADP is seeking a Quality Assurance Engineer to join our development team. As a Quality Assurance Engineer, you will be responsible for building and debugging ADP's cloud-based AI and machine learning-enhanced payroll, tax, HR, and benefits solutions.Key Responsibilities* Write and advise on high-quality, efficient, and maintainable automation...


  • Barcelona, Barcelona, España Flight Centre Travel Group A tiempo completo

    We are seeking a Quality Assurance Engineer II to join our team at Flight Centre Travel Group. As a key member of our software development team, you will be responsible for ensuring the quality of our products and services.The ideal candidate will have a strong background in software testing and quality assurance, with experience in test automation and...


  • Barcelona, Barcelona, España Semrush A tiempo completo

    Job DescriptionWe are seeking a skilled Senior Quality Assurance Engineer to join our team at Semrush. As a key member of our Competitive Intelligence Unit, you will play a crucial role in developing and maintaining our products for domain traffic and market analytics.The ideal candidate will have a strong background in software testing and quality...


  • Barcelona, Barcelona, España Adp A tiempo completo

    Quality Assurance Automation EngineerAs a Quality Assurance Automation Engineer at ADP, you will play a critical role in ensuring the quality of our cloud-based products. You will be responsible for developing and maintaining automated tests using Playwright for UI, API, visual, and accessibility testing. This is a fantastic opportunity to work with a...


  • Barcelona, Barcelona, España Flight Centre Travel Group A tiempo completo

    About the OpportunityWe are seeking a highly skilled Quality Assurance Engineer to join our team at Flight Centre Travel Group. As a key member of our agile development team, you will be responsible for ensuring the highest quality of our products and services.Key ResponsibilitiesWork in an agile environment and adhere to all QA best practices.Perform...


  • Barcelona, Barcelona, España Adp A tiempo completo

    About the Role:We are seeking a highly skilled Quality Assurance Engineer to join our team at ADP. As a Quality Assurance Engineer, you will be responsible for designing and implementing automated tests to ensure the quality of our cloud-based AI and machine learning-enhanced payroll, tax, HR, and benefits solutions.Key Responsibilities:Develop and maintain...


  • Barcelona, Barcelona, España Semrush A tiempo completo

    Job DescriptionWe are seeking a skilled Senior Quality Assurance Engineer to join our team at Semrush. As a key member of our Iris Team, you will play a crucial role in ensuring the quality and reliability of our product.Key ResponsibilitiesDevelop and maintain automated testing tools and scriptsDesign and implement testing documents and strategiesExecute...


  • Barcelona, Barcelona, España Semrush A tiempo completo

    **Job Title:** Senior Quality Assurance Engineer (Lion Team)**About the Role:**We are seeking a highly skilled Senior Quality Assurance Engineer to join our Lion team at Semrush. As a key member of our team, you will be responsible for ensuring the quality of our Review Management product in Semrush Local.**Key Responsibilities:** Develop and execute...


  • Barcelona, Barcelona, España Gtlinkers A tiempo completo

    Job Title: Senior Quality Assurance EngineerAbout the Role:At Gtlinkers, we are seeking a highly skilled Senior Quality Assurance Engineer to join our team in Madrid. As a key member of our QA team, you will be responsible for defining and driving the QA strategy for our Spanish division, collaborating closely with international teams.Key...


  • Barcelona, Barcelona, España Semrush A tiempo completo

    Job Description:We are seeking a skilled Senior Quality Assurance Engineer to join our team at Semrush. As a key member of our Iris Team, you will be responsible for developing test tools and automatic tests, designing testing documents, and executing manual and automatic tests on our product API and services.Key Responsibilities:Developing test tools and...


  • Barcelona, Barcelona, España Semrush A tiempo completo

    At Semrush, we are looking for a skilled Quality Assurance Engineer to join our team. As a Quality Assurance Engineer, you will be responsible for ensuring the quality of our product by testing the front-end and back-end parts of the tool, improving the quality of the product, making technical decisions, and implementing them.Key responsibilities...


  • Barcelona, Barcelona, España Tui A tiempo completo

    About the RoleWe are seeking a highly skilled Senior Automation Quality Engineer to join our team. As a key member of our quality engineering team, you will be responsible for delivering high-quality software products and ensuring that our applications meet the highest standards of quality.Key ResponsibilitiesDevelop and maintain efficient, highly automated...